Join our team at Kim's K-9 if you're ready to embark on a rewarding journey in animal care!Responsibilities:
  • Kennel techs spend most of their day on a play floor with a large group of off-leash dogs, of any size
  • You will practice manners, engage dogs in enrichment activities, and generally manage, feed, and clean up after those dogs for the day
  • Kennel techs will train to feed and medicate dogs who stay overnight for boarding
  • Kennel techs will help bathe dogs before they go home
  • Kennel techs will receive an in-depth education on dog body language and non-verbal, social communication in order to understand their groups better and stop conflict before it escalates
  • Kennel techs will use tools and techniques used by our staff for decades to successfully eliminate jumping, door dashing, and avoidance behaviors from dogs
  • Kennel techs must be able to lift, pull, push and do hard work in between managing the dogs in groups. It keeps off the summer pounds
